
Gora Kadan
Formal, unhurried, and intensely attentive — this is traditional Japanese ryokan culture executed at an extremely high level. No flashy design statements. Think natural wood, garden views, seasonal flower arrangements, and the quiet ritual of the bath.

Gora Kadan sits on the grounds of the former Kan'in-no-miya Imperial Villa — one of Japan's four branch families of the imperial household — on a hillside in the Gora district of Hakone National Park. The architecture is pure sukiya-zukuri: exposed timber frames, shoji paper screens, tatami floors, a 120-meter-long pillared corridor, and gardens that predate the ryokan itself. Hot spring water flows directly from private on-site sources, and kaiseki dinner is served course by course in your room by kimono-clad attendants. You get a dedicated room concierge for the duration of your stay.

Two day-use plans available: (1) Lunch at Kaiseki Kadan plus privately reserved open-air bath; (2) Lunch at Kaiseki Kadan plus beauty treatment at Kadan Spa. The lounge HANAKAGE and Gift Shop are also available to day visitors.
Private guided hiking tours through Hakone's trails, arranged through explore-hakone.com.
Hotel-arranged sightseeing cruise on Lake Ashi. Take bus line H bound for Lake Ashinoko; the property offers a pickup from Kowakien by car. Routes to Moto-Hakone Port and Moto-Hakone Town available.
Arranged excursion to the 5th stage of Mt. Fuji — the highest point accessible by road. Best in summer when the mountain is open.
Complimentary pickup service to select nearby museums: Okada Museum of Art, Hakone Open Air Museum, and Hakone Museum of Art. A convenient way to reach Hakone's art circuit without arranging your own transport.
Motorboat cruising and canoe/kayak tours arranged on Lake Ashi, roughly 25 minutes from the property.

Warm-water indoor pool set in a space reminiscent of an orangery. Open daily 8:00am–6:30pm for all guests; 10:00am–6:30pm for junior high school students and younger. Complimentary for staying guests. Swimwear available for purchase.
24-hour front desk with concierge, currency exchange, and luggage storage. A dedicated room concierge is assigned to each guest group for attentive omotenashi.

Call reception upon arrival at Gora Station and a Mercedes-Benz will collect you. Reservation required. Limousine upgrades (Toyota Alphard, BMW, Toyota HiAce jumbo taxi) available for an additional fee.
Mildly alkaline hot spring water from private on-site sources. Gender-separated public baths that rotate at night so you can experience both during a stay. Open for overnight guests.
Reservable open-air bath with steam sauna attached. Available to all guests for 40-minute slots at no additional charge. Book at reception.
Natural rock bedrock bath said to emit far infrared rays with a strong detox effect.
